#44041e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#44041e is composed of 26.7% red, 1.6%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 55.9%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 335.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 14.1%. #44041e color hex could be obtained by blending #88083c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#44041e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0105 is the darkest color, while #fff9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#44041e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262224 is the less saturated color, while #47011d is the most saturated one.
